Alexander Vasilyev is a scholar working on Global and Planetary Change, Atmospheric Science and Aerospace Engineering. According to data from OpenAlex, Alexander Vasilyev has authored 25 papers receiving a total of 182 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Global and Planetary Change, 9 papers in Atmospheric Science and 7 papers in Aerospace Engineering. Recurrent topics in Alexander Vasilyev's work include Atmospheric aerosols and clouds (11 papers), Atmospheric Ozone and Climate (9 papers) and Calibration and Measurement Techniques (6 papers). Alexander Vasilyev is often cited by papers focused on Atmospheric aerosols and clouds (11 papers), Atmospheric Ozone and Climate (9 papers) and Calibration and Measurement Techniques (6 papers). Alexander Vasilyev collaborates with scholars based in Russia, Greece and United States. Alexander Vasilyev's co-authors include Irina Melnikova, Elena Kazennova, Bobkova Mr, Arthur P. Cracknell, Costas A. Varotsos, Chris G. Tzanis, Yu. M. Timofeyev, Ronald M. Welch, Dmitry Pozdnyakov and E. N. Ermakova and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Atmospheric chemistry and physics and International Journal of Remote Sensing.
